One was talking with the young actors from New Prague High School's spring play, An Inconvenient Squirrel. From what I've seen from practices it offers a lot of fun and the students were enjoying it. One practice had some bloopers that had the cast chuckling. I'm not surprised that the show is funny as Joe Scrimshaw, a Twin Cities theatre artist, wrote it. I've seen shows he's written or acted in with his brother, Joshua. The two have done a variety of productions, some at the Twin Cities annual Fringe Festival. If you've never heard of it, the Fringe Festival is a collection of short plays, dance theater and even the occasional musical. It ranges from the serious to the comedic and is held in the fall.

Another event I went to was at the Science Museum. It currently has the display Real Pirates that details the lives of actual pirates. It includes items from the Whydah, an actual pirate ship. There are also re-enactors of the crew plus a few others like Blackbeard, historical figures who have had more than their fair share of fictional stories told about them.
